IDFC FIRST Bank
IDFC FIRST Bank

Developer (Java Backend)

onsite
Bangalore, India
Posted 2/6/2026
Exp: 0-0y

Job Overview

IDFC FIRST Bank is actively hiring for the role of Developer. This is a prime opportunity for B.E / B.Tech Freshers (0 Years Experience) to join the Cutting-Edge Technology Team in Bangalore. If you have proficiency in Java, Spring Boot, and SQL, check the details below and apply immediately.

Role: Developer (Backend) Location: Bangalore, Karnataka Experience: Freshers (0 Years) Qualification: B.E / B.Tech Key Skills: Java, Spring Boot, SQL, Docker, Kubernetes Job Type: Full-time Salary: Best in Industry

Job Description

For the IDFC FIRST Bank drive, the bank is seeking a Java Backend Developer to join their Technology Team. You will be responsible for designing, developing, and maintaining backend services and APIs that support the digital banking platform.

This role involves working with modern technologies like Docker, Kubernetes, and CI/CD pipelines. You will apply Test-Driven Development (TDD) practices and troubleshoot production issues to ensure high availability of banking services.

Roles and Responsibilities

As a Developer at IDFC FIRST Bank, your key responsibilities will include:

  • Backend Development: Developing backend endpoints end-to-end including router, service layer, and repository using Java and Spring Boot.
  • API Integration: Creating and integrating APIs with existing systems.
  • Database Management: Writing SQL queries to store, fetch, and process data using Oracle Database.
  • DevOps & Monitoring: Understanding CI/CD pipelines and working with tools like Docker and Kubernetes. Utilizing tools like Grafana and Dynatrace for monitoring.
  • Testing: Applying unit testing frameworks and practicing Test-Driven Development (TDD).
  • Collaboration: Participating in scrum meetings and collaborating in testing and deployment processes.

Skills and Eligibility Criteria

To be eligible for IDFC FIRST Bank drive, candidates must meet the following criteria:

  • Educational Background: Bachelor’s degree in Engineering (B.E / B.Tech).
  • Experience: Zero years of experience (Freshers).
  • Mandatory Technical Skills:
    • Proficiency in Java and Spring Boot.
    • Strong SQL skills and experience with Oracle Database.
    • Familiarity with REST APIs and unit testing frameworks.
  • Preferred Skills (Bonus):
    • Knowledge of CI/CD pipelines.
    • Exposure to containerization tools like Docker and Kubernetes.
    • Ability to troubleshoot and resolve production issues.

Selection Process

The selection process for IDFC FIRST Bank typically includes:

  • Resume Screening: Shortlisting based on Java/Spring Boot projects.
  • Online Technical Test: Coding questions (DSA in Java) and Database queries.
  • Technical Interview: Deep dive into Spring Boot annotations, REST API design, and SQL.
  • HR Interview: Cultural fit and behavioral assessment.

About the Company

IDFC FIRST Bank is a new-age universal bank in India, built on the foundations of ethical banking, digital innovation, and social responsibility. With a strong focus on technology, the bank is transforming the banking experience for millions of customers. Joining IDFC FIRST Bank means working in a high-growth environment that values integrity, transparency, and customer-first thinking.